How much do data engineering j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for data engineering in Elgin, IL is $163,122.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$132,000.00 and $168,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a data engineer do?

Data Engineers regularly design, build, and maintain scalable data pipelines to support analytics and business intelligence teams. Their daily tasks often involve working with large datasets, optimizing data storage, ensuring data integrity, and troubleshooting data-related issues. Collaboration with data scientists, analysts, and software engineers is common to align on data requirements and improve workflows. You may also participate in regular code reviews and contribute to the ongoing improvement of data infrastructure. This role is ideal for problem-solvers who enjoy working with both code and complex systems in a collaborative, fast-paced environment.

What is data engineering?

A Data Engineering job involves designing, building, and maintaining the infrastructure that enables efficient data collection, storage, and processing. Data Engineers develop pipelines to transform raw data into usable formats for analytics and machine learning. They work with databases, big data technologies, and cloud platforms to ensure data is accessible and reliable. Their role is crucial for organizations to make data-driven decisions and optimize business processes.

Are data engineers still in demand?

Data engineers are currently in high demand due to the increasing reliance on data-driven decision making and the growth of big data technologies. They are essential for building and maintaining data pipelines, often working with tools like Apache Spark, Hadoop, and cloud platforms, and typically require strong programming and database skills. The demand is expected to remain strong as organizations continue to prioritize data infrastructure.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a data engineer?

To thrive in Data Engineering, you need a solid background in programming (such as Python, Java, or Scala), data modeling, and database management, typically sup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with ETL tools, cloud platforms like AWS or Azure, big data frameworks (e.g., Hadoop, Spark), and relevant certifications is highly valued.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and the ability to work collaboratively across teams are key soft skills for this role. These attributes are crucial for designing robust data pipelines, ensuring data quality, and enabling organizations to make data-driven decisions efficiently.

Job Overview
The Data Engineering Lead is responsible for driving the modern data engineering foundation at Rewards Network while providing technical leadership across both data engineering and data science functions. The team is mid-migration -actively building on a modern stack- and this role exists to ensure disciplined execution, enforce architectural clarity and consistency.
The right person is a hands-on player-coach that is comfortable building teams as we invest in building out this competency as a core pillar of our long-term competitive advantage and strategy. That means assessing the current in-flight build and making deliberate decisions about what to keep and what to replace. Initially, the Data Engineering Lead will also manage the Data Science team, including acting as a key resource to the team, prioritizing work, and clearing roadblocks.
This is a hybrid position that requires in office presence 3 days a week (Tuesday-Thursday) in Chicago.
What you'll bring to the table: (Responsibilities)
  • Establish and enforce architecture standards that ensure consistent designs that produce repeatable results.
  • Assess the current state of our data infrastructure - evaluate what needs refactoring, and what should be replaced - then execute on that plan with the team.
  • Lead the continued build-out of the modern data stack, including ELT pipelines, stream ingestion, transformation logic along with storage and compute - serving as the technical authority when the team needs a decision made.
  • Hire and develop data engineering talent, grow the team with engineers experienced in modern ELT architectures and develop the existing team members through mentorship, code review, and technical leadership.
  • Define and maintain the data model RFC process, reviewing proposed changes, enforcing boundary discipline, and ensuring no undocumented changes promote to canonical layers.
  • Directly lead the data science team, setting priorities, managing workstreams, and translating business problems into clearly scoped DS projects - fostering a culture of accountability, technical rigor, and continuous improvement.
  • Own data pipeline monitoring and observability, ensuring production pipelines have appropriate alerting, data quality checks, and incident response processes so failures are caught early and resolved quickly.
  • Provide regular visibility into team progress, architectural decisions, and risks to senior leadership, communicating tradeoffs clearly and escalating when business commitments are at risk.
Do you have the right mix of ingredients: (Requirements)
  •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Engineering, or related field (or equivalent experience)
  • 6-10 years of experience in data engineering or a closely related discipline
  • 2+ years in a technical lead or staff-level individual contributor role
  • Familiarity with data science workflows, ML model lifecycle, and MLOps concepts
  • Expertise in data engineering - including model design, testing strategy, incremental patterns, and layer boundary governance
  • Experience designing and enforcing data modeling standards in a team environment - not just building models, but establishing the patterns others follow
  • Demonstrated ability to bring a team along technically - through code review, documentation, mentorship, and setting standards that stick
  • Familiarity with CI/CD for data pipelines (GitLab or equivalent) - including automated testing, deployment workflows, and environment promotion strategies
  • Experience with data observability and monitoring - alerting on pipeline failures, data quality degradation, and freshness SLAs (familiarity with tools like Elementary, Monte Carlo, or equivalent)
  • Strong decision-making under ambiguity - this role requires someone who can move forward with incomplete information and course-correct, not someone who needs consensus to proceed
  • Clear, direct communicator who can translate technical tradeoffs for non-technical stakeholders
  • Technical expertise in: Python, Apache Airflow, Apache Kafka, cloud data warehouses (Redshift, GBQ, Databricks)
